Orthotics are prescription medical devices worn by the patients inside their shoes to correct musculoskeletal issues that affect walking, running or standing.   • Pain and swelling in the feet – if even the simplest of everyday activities causes you foot pain, and swelling is also a frequent experience, the problem might be helped by the right type of orthotics, tailor-made to your feet;
  • Sharp pain in the heels – this could be a sign of plantar fasciitis, the inflammation of the thick band of tissue that connects your heel to the toes. A custom-made device will help with the condition by providing adequate support for the arch of your foot and cushioning for the heel;
  • Flat feet and high arches – these two deformations can also be very efficiently treated with orthotics;
  • Your shoes are not wearing evenly – even if you do not have any foot pain yet, the uneven wearing of your shoes indicates that you do not use both feet the same way. Orthotics can help restore even limb usage and can prevent the development of dysfunction and the appearance of pain;
  • Balance issues – if standing on one foot is a problem or if you have frequent falls due to a problem with balance, orthotics can give you more stability and can also reduce the risk of falls.
